Frequently Asked Questions

What should I verify about permits and codes when hiring a roofing contractor in Monument?

The Town of Monument Building Department requires permits for all roof replacements, enforcing 2021 IRC amendments that specify ice and water shield installation in valleys and eaves. Colorado lacks statewide licensing, so verify contractor registration with local municipalities. Current code mandates specific flashing offsets and material certifications that unregistered contractors often overlook, creating compliance issues that affect insurance coverage and home resale value.

I've noticed mold in my attic. Could this be related to my roof's ventilation?

Improper ventilation on Monument's common 4/12 pitch roofs creates attic moisture accumulation that leads to mold growth. The 2021 IRC with Town amendments requires specific intake and exhaust ratios to maintain air exchange, preventing condensation on OSB decking. Inadequate venting traps warm, moist air that deteriorates roofing materials from beneath while increasing cooling costs and creating ideal conditions for mold and wood rot.

Should I consider solar shingles instead of traditional asphalt when replacing my roof?

Solar shingles offer integrated energy generation but cost 2-3 times more than premium architectural asphalt in 2026. With Black Hills Energy net metering and the 30% federal tax credit, the payback period for solar shingles in Monument is 12-15 years versus 5-7 years for traditional roofs with separate solar panels. Consider your energy consumption, roof orientation, and whether you prioritize immediate storm protection or long-term energy independence.

My homeowner insurance premium increased significantly this year. Can roof upgrades actually lower my bill?

Colorado's current 38% premium trend makes roof upgrades financially strategic. Installing an IBHS FORTIFIED Home-certified roof provides documented wind and hail resistance that insurers reward with premium reductions of 15-25%. These systems meet strict attachment and material standards, reducing claim frequency and severity. In Monument, this investment often pays for itself within 5-7 years through insurance savings alone.

My roof looks fine from the ground. Why would I need a professional inspection?

Traditional visual inspections miss sub-surface moisture trapped within architectural asphalt shingle layers. AI-enhanced aerial photogrammetry and drone thermal imaging detect moisture patterns invisible to walk-over inspections, identifying compromised areas before leaks manifest indoors. This technology maps entire roof planes in Monument to pinpoint exact repair locations, preventing unnecessary full replacements when targeted repairs suffice.

With Monument's severe storm season, what roof features matter most for durability?

Monument's 115 mph ultimate wind speed zone and frequent 2-inch hail require Class 4 impact-resistant shingles as a financial necessity. These shingles withstand hailstones traveling at terminal velocity without granule loss that leads to premature aging. Combined with proper deck attachment and sealed roof edges, this system survives May-August convective storms that routinely damage standard roofs, preventing costly emergency repairs and insurance claims.
